The resolving power of a telescope is its ability to produce separate images of two closely spaced objects/ sources. We can also define it as reciprocal of the smallest angular separation between two distant objects whose images are seen separately. Resolving Power = dθ1= 1.22λa.

The ability of microscopes, telescopes, or any optical device to resolve two nearly situated objects as independent objects is referred to as resolving power.
